Understanding Traditional Indian Massage

Before delving into the preparations, let's first understand what traditional Indian massage entails. Indian massage is deeply rooted in the ancient Indian healing system called Ayurveda. Ayurveda focuses on restoring balance and harmony within the body, using various techniques, including massage, herbal remedies, and lifestyle modifications. Indian massage promotes relaxation, detoxification, and energy flow through specific rhythmic movements, herbal oils, and focused pressure points.

1. Research and Choose a Reputable Spa or Therapist

When preparing for a traditional Indian massage, it is essential to research and selects a reputable spa or therapist. Look for establishments specializing in Ayurvedic treatments and have experienced therapists who are well-versed in traditional Indian massage techniques. Reading reviews and seeking recommendations from trusted sources can help you make an informed decision.

2. Familiarize Yourself with the Massage Techniques

Take some time to familiarize yourself with the specific massage techniques used in traditional Indian massage. Different strokes, such as long sweeping motions, circular movements, and gentle kneading, are applied during the massage session. Understanding these techniques will enable you to better appreciate and communicate your preferences to the therapist.

3. Hydrate and Cleanse Your Body

Hydrating and cleansing your body before an Indian massage session is crucial for optimum results. Drink plenty of water throughout the day to keep your body well-hydrated and aid in detoxification. A warm shower or bath before the massage helps relax your muscles and prepare your body for the therapeutic experience.

4. Choose Suitable Attire

Selecting the proper attire can significantly enhance your comfort during the massage. Opt for loose-fitting and lightweight clothing made from natural fabrics such as cotton. This allows easy movement and helps the therapist access various body parts without restrictions.

5. Arrive Early and Relax

To fully prepare for the traditional Indian massage, arrive a few minutes early at the spa or therapist's location. This will give you ample time to unwind, switch off from daily stresses, and enter a state of relaxation. Use this time to breathe deeply, meditate, or enjoy the peaceful surroundings.

6. Communicate Your Needs and Preferences

Clear communication with your therapist ensures a personalized and satisfying massage experience. Discuss any specific needs, preferences, or concerns you may have before the session begins. Whether it's adjusting the pressure, focusing on certain areas of the body, or using specific oils, make sure to convey your requirements.

7. Relaxation Techniques

Before the massage, the therapist may guide you through relaxation techniques to calm your mind and body. These may include deep breathing exercises, meditation, or gentle stretches. Practicing these techniques will help you enter a state of deep relaxation and enhance the effects of the massage.

8. Prepare Your Mind and Emotions

Preparing your mind and emotions is equally important as training your body for an Indian massage. Set aside any distractions, worries, or negative thoughts, and allow yourself to be present in the moment. Embrace the opportunity to rejuvenate not just physically but also mentally and emotionally. Take a few moments to engage in activities that help calm your mind, such as listening to soothing music or practicing mindfulness. This will create a conducive environment for the massage and allow you to immerse yourself in the experience fully.

9. Be Open to the Healing Power of Ayurvedic Oils

Traditional Indian massage involves using Ayurvedic oils, which are carefully selected based on your needs and body type. These oils have therapeutic properties and can deeply nourish your skin, relax your muscles, and promote overall well-being. Embrace the healing power of these oils and be open to their transformative effects on your body and mind.

10.Prepare for Post-Massage Care

After the massage, allowing your body to absorb the benefits and continue the relaxation process is essential. Plan some downtime for yourself, avoiding any strenuous activities or tasks that may disrupt the tranquility you've achieved. Drink plenty of water to aid in flushing out toxins and rehydrate your body. Take this opportunity to rest, reflect, and fully embrace the rejuvenation you've experienced.

11. Maintain a Balanced Lifestyle

While a traditional Indian massage can provide immediate relaxation and rejuvenation, it's essential to incorporate Ayurvedic principles into your daily life to maintain overall balance and well-being. This includes adopting a balanced diet, exercising regularly, practicing stress management techniques, and embracing self-care practices that promote harmony within your mind, body, and soul.

12. Seek Professional Guidance

If you're new to traditional Indian massage or Ayurveda, consider seeking professional guidance from an Ayurvedic practitioner. They can provide personalized recommendations based on your unique needs and guide you in implementing Ayurvedic principles into your lifestyle. Their expertise and knowledge will ensure you derive maximum benefits from your massage and maintain a holistic approach to well-being.

FAQs (Frequently Asked Questions)

1. Is traditional Indian massage suitable for everyone?

Traditional Indian massage is generally suitable for most people. However, it's essential to consult with a healthcare professional if you have any specific health concerns or conditions.

2. How long does a traditional Indian massage session typically last?

A traditional Indian massage session can vary, usually lasting between 60 to 90 minutes. However, some spas may offer longer sessions for a more comprehensive experience.

3. Are there any side effects of traditional Indian massage?

Traditional Indian massage is generally safe and has minimal side effects. However, some individuals may experience temporary soreness, redness, or sensitivity in some body regions.

4. Can pregnant women receive a traditional Indian massage?

Pregnant women should consult their healthcare provider before receiving a traditional Indian massage. Some modifications and precautions may be necessary during pregnancy.

5. How often should I get a traditional Indian massage?

The frequency of traditional Indian massage sessions depends on your individual needs and preferences. Some people may benefit from weekly sessions, while others may opt for monthly or occasional treatments.
